기억보단 기록을/React Native

반응형
기억보단 기록을/React Native

[React Native] 안드로이드 RBSheet 안에 있는 인풋 클릭시 활성화되는 키보드 때문에 레이아웃 위로 올라가는 이슈 해결방법

해당 글은 2022년 7월에 작성한 글입니다. 원인 현재 사용중인 RBSheet 모듈은 react-native-raw-bottom-sheet인데 2년 동안 업데이트가 없을 정도로 관리가 안되고 있는 모듈입니다. 이 모듈은 react-native-modal을 dependence하고 있는데 KeyboardAvoidingView를 비활성화해도안드로이드에서만 키보드 활성화 시 빈 공간만큼 모달이 올라갑니다. 해결방법 해당 모듈의 내부 코드에있는 Modal 속성에 있는 statusBarTranslucent 의 값을 활성화 합니다 statusBarTranslucent는 모달이 시스템 상태 표시줄 아래에 있어야 하는지 여부를 결정하는데 기본값이 false라서 빈 공간이 있으면 상태바 아래까지 모달이 올라갑니다 급한 ..

기억보단 기록을/React Native

React Native 컴포넌트 관리를 위한 Bit

해당 글은 2021년 11월 21에 작성된 글입니다. 우리는 컴포넌트 관리&공유가 필요할까? 컴포넌트 공유가 필요한 프로젝트는 몇 개입니까? - 3개 이상 컴포넌트를 공유해야 하는 프로젝트는 얼마나 유사합니까? 예를 들어, 모두 동일한 구성의 동일한 CLI를 기반으로 합니까? -모두 React Native로 개발 진행 중 - 새로운 프로젝트를 시작할 때 마다 src/Components/* 를 복사 붙혀넣기 하고 있음 -이전 프로젝트와 비슷한 기능 또는 디자인이 있다면 코드를 참고하고 있음 공용으로 사용되는 컴포넌트들을 관리하는 저장소가 있습니까? - 있지만 최신화가 잘 안돼있음 - 컴포넌트의 사소한 기능이나 디자인이 바뀌어도 모듈의 버전을 업데이트해야됨 공유 구성 요소를 구축하는 전담 팀이 있습니까? -..

반응형
_OIL
'기억보단 기록을/React Native' 카테고리의 글 목록